Frequently asked questions about holiday rentals in England

  • What are the must-see places in England?

    England boasts a wealth of iconic landmarks. Buckingham Palace in London is a must, as is the Tower of London with its Crown Jewels. Other highlights include the historic Stonehenge, the Roman Baths in Bath, and the picturesque Cotswolds villages. For art and culture, the British Museum and the National Gallery in London are essential, while the Shakespeare's Globe offers a unique theatrical experience.

  • What are the typical activities to do in England?

    Activities vary greatly depending on your interests. London offers world-class theatre, museums, and shopping. Exploring historic castles like Windsor Castle or Warwick Castle is popular. The Lake District provides opportunities for hiking and watersports, while the Yorkshire Dales offer stunning scenery for walking and cycling. Afternoon tea is a quintessential English experience.

  • Which part of England offers the most pleasant climate?

    England's climate is generally temperate, but the south coast enjoys the warmest temperatures and the most sunshine. Areas like Cornwall and Devon often have milder weather than the rest of the country.

  • Are there specific challenges to driving in England that visitors should know?

    Driving in England can be challenging for visitors. Driving is on the left-hand side of the road, and roundabouts are common. Narrow, winding country lanes can be tricky to navigate, and parking in cities can be expensive and difficult to find. Understanding the Highway Code is essential.

  • What are the top festivals to experience in England?

    England hosts numerous festivals throughout the year. The Notting Hill Carnival in London is a vibrant celebration of Caribbean culture. Glastonbury Festival is a massive music festival. Smaller, more local events are numerous, and their schedules vary year to year.
  • What is the best time of year to visit England?

    The best time to visit depends on your preferences. Summer (June-August) offers warm weather and long daylight hours, ideal for outdoor activities. Spring (March-May) and autumn (September-November) provide p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. Winter (December-February) can be cold and wet, but offers a unique charm.
  • What are some local dishes to try in England?

    Traditional English dishes include Sunday roast (usually beef, lamb, or chicken with roast potatoes and vegetables), fish and chips, and full English breakfast (eggs, bacon, sausage, beans, toast, etc.). Other regional specialities vary widely.
  • What emergency numbers should you know in case of a medical or security issue in England?

    In case of a medical emergency, dial 999. For non-emergency situations, contact your local police or hospital.
  • What etiquette tips are important when visiting England?

    Queuing is important in England. Saying 'please' and 'thank you' is always appreciated. Generally, the English tend to be reserved, so avoid overly familiar behaviour. Tipping in restaurants is customary (around 10-15%).
  • What are the best areas to spend a week in England?

    A week allows for exploring different regions. A possible itinerary could involve a few days in London, followed by exploring the Cotswolds or the Lake District. Alternatively, you could focus on a specific area like Cornwall or Yorkshire, allowing for deeper exploration.
  • What are the best areas to spend a weekend in England?

    For a weekend break, London is a great option, offering a huge range of sights and activities. Alternatively, a charming city like Bath or York provides a more relaxed atmosphere with historical sites and beautiful architecture. Coastal towns like Brighton or Canterbury also make for pleasant weekend getaways.
  • What are the top shopping destinations in England?

    London offers unparalleled shopping opportunities, from high-end department stores like Harrods and Selfridges to independent boutiques in areas like Notting Hill and Shoreditch. Other cities like Manchester and Birmingham also have vibrant shopping scenes.
  • What are some off-the-beaten-path places to explore in England?

    The Peak District National Park offers stunning landscapes away from the main tourist trails. The Northumberland National Park in the north of England provides dramatic scenery and historic sites. The Isles of Scilly offer a tranquil escape with beautiful beaches and clear waters.
